    Melanoma Identification Through X-ray Modality Using Inception-v3 Based Convolutional Neural Network

    Saad Awadh Alanazi*

    CMC-Computers, Materials & Continua, Vol.72, No.1, pp. 37-55, 2022, DOI:10.32604/cmc.2022.020118

    Abstract Melanoma, also called malignant melanoma, is a form of skin cancer triggered by an abnormal proliferation of the pigment-producing cells, which give the skin its color. Melanoma is one of the skin diseases, which is exceptionally and globally dangerous, Skin lesions are considered to be a serious disease. Dermoscopy-based early recognition and detection procedure is fundamental for melanoma treatment. Early detection of melanoma using dermoscopy images improves survival rates significantly. At the same time, well-experienced dermatologists dominate the precision of diagnosis.
